I would list it with a very high price (at the top of the range the realtor suggests).
I have seen two people fall in love with trophy properties at auctions, and they will bid the heck out of it. Hopefully someone will also fall in love with your listing!
[Unless of course, you have to do a quick sale. Sometimes you just have to trade off money for time.]
